What is now Inn Street is roughly the area where the fire started in l811destroying much of Market Square. Inn Street was laid out in l8l8 as part of the reconstruction on the area after the fire.

Most of the buildings on Inn Street were demolished as part of Urban Renewal in the late 1960s and early 1970s. The demolition of the area was stopped and restoration and renewal was adopted. Today Inn Street is a thriving pedestrian mall, it was completed in 1974 and downtown Newburyport is a national example of historic preservation. ~ History courtesy of the City of Newburyport, Historic Property Surveys
